
Business, Management, and Administration Cluster
Planning, managing, and providing administrative support, information processing, accounting, and human resource management services and related management support services.

Administrative and Information Support
Employees in the Administration and Information Support program of study use technology to perform and coordinate the administrative activities of an office and to ensure that information is collected and disseminated to staff and clients.

Business Analysis
People with careers in the Business Analysis program of study analyze business problems and situations, and then formulate and communicate appropriate solutions. Employees in this cluster research and study business data to create solutions that are the most cost-effective and beneficial to the business while promoting its philosophies and strategies. This program of study also includes the use of business statistics to study and analyze data, teamwork to analyze and formulate solutions, and communication with clients to obtain information and to present projections and solutions.

Business Financial Management & Accounting
Employees in the Business Financial Management and Accounting program of study help design, install, maintain and use general accounting systems to prepare, analyze and verify financial reports and related economic information to help make important financial decisions for an organization.

Business Management
Employees working in the Management program of study focus on preparation and execution of business activities; supervision of other employees; maintenance of facilities, equipment and supplies; organization of operations and production; utilization of marketing functions to ensure success; performance of financial functions; communication with customers, clients and others; performance of administrative functions; and use of professional services.

Communications Development
Employees in the Communications Development program of study manage products and services; conduct research; promote, sell and maintain products and services; and handle communications both inside and outside the organization.

Human Resources
Employees working in the Human Resources program of study recruit, interview and hire the most qualified employees and match them to the positions for which they are best suited.
